The Lead Civil Engineer will be responsible for the technical deliverables from the Civil Engineering Team. This includes ensuring quality and CDM2015 compliance of technical delivery. The role requires reviewing and implementing appropriate procedures and principles to safeguard this, alongside ensuring the competency of the civil engineering team to deliver their roles and responsibilities. The post holder will manage and coordinate multiple projects through the project teams.
Although this role offers flexible/hybrid working (office/home), you will be expected to travel to any location or site within South East Water’s supply areas, as required, as part of the project(s) you or your team are working on, e.g., pre-construction and construction phase elements such as scoping or Contractor progress/design review meetings, defect reviews, etc.
